pip install SpeechRecognition 使用国内的源
时间: 2023-09-26 18:11:21 浏览: 52
可以使用以下命令来使用国内的源安装 SpeechRecognition:
```
pip install -i https://pypi.tuna.tsinghua.edu.cn/simple SpeechRecognition
```
其中,`-i` 参数指定使用的源地址,这里使用了清华大学的镜像源。如果你想使用其他的源,可以将链接替换为相应的地址。
相关问题
换源pip speech_recognition as sr
pip是Python的包管理工具,用于安装和管理Python包。而speech_recognition是一个Python语音识别库,可以用于识别和转录语音。
要安装speech_recognition库,可以使用pip命令来进行安装。在终端或命令提示符中输入以下命令即可:
```
pip install SpeechRecognition
```
安装完成后,你就可以在Python代码中使用speech_recognition库了。下面是一个简单的示例代码,演示了如何使用speech_recognition库进行语音识别:
```python
import speech_recognition as sr
# 创建一个Recognizer对象
r = sr.Recognizer()
# 使用麦克风录音
with sr.Microphone() as source:
print("请说话...")
audio = r.listen(source)
# 将录音转换为文本
try:
text = r.recognize_google(audio, language='zh-CN')
print("识别结果:" + text)
except sr.UnknownValueError:
print("无法识别")
except sr.RequestError as e:
print("请求错误:" + str(e))
```
这段代码首先导入了speech_recognition库,并创建了一个Recognizer对象。然后使用麦克风录音,并将录音转换为文本。最后,通过调用recognize_google方法将语音转换为文本,并打印出识别结果。
speechrecognition使用
您好!要使用Python中的`speechrecognition`库进行语音识别,您需要先安装该库。可以通过以下命令使用pip安装:
```
pip install SpeechRecognition
```
安装完成后,您可以使用以下示例代码进行语音识别:
```python
import speech_recognition as sr
# 创建Recognizer对象
r = sr.Recognizer()
# 使用麦克风录音
with sr.Microphone() as source:
print("请开始说话:")
audio = r.listen(source)
# 将音频转换为文本
try:
text = r.recognize_google(audio, language='zh***') # 使用Google进行语音识别,语言为中文
print("识别结果:", text)
except sr.UnknownValueError:
print("无法识别语音")
except sr.RequestError as e:
print("请求错误:", str(e))
```
以上代码会使用麦克风录制一段音频,并将其转换为文本。语音识别结果会打印在控制台上。
请注意,此示例使用了Google的语音识别API,因此需要确保您的计算机可以访问Google服务。如果您遇到任何问题,请确保已正确设置麦克风,并检查与网络连接相关的问题。
希望能对您有所帮助!如果您有任何其他问题,请随时提问。